Tony Hawk’s Pro Skater 1+2 PS5 and Xbox Series X performance analyzed side by side – Gamesradar
Better resolution than advertised, at least in one case

A new Tony Hawk’s Pro Skater 1+2 PS5 and Xbox Series X|S graphics comparison video breaks down how the new versions of the skateboarding game handle the new generation of consoles.
The new versions of the game – which are included with the Digital Deluxe Edition of the last-gen version, and available as a $10 paid upgrade for owners of the standard digital version – impressed the tech analysts at Digital Foundry when they broke down their performance against each other and their last-gen counterparts….
